Veeva Systems Inc. (NYSE:VEEV) Receives $247.08 Consensus Target Price from Brokerages

Veeva Systems Inc. (NYSE:VEEVGet Free Report) has received a consensus rating of “Moderate Buy” from the twenty-eight analysts that are covering the stock, MarketBeat Ratings reports. One investment analyst has rated the stock with a sell rating, eight have given a hold rating, eighteen have assigned a buy rating and one has issued a strong buy rating on the company. The average twelve-month price target among analysts that have issued ratings on the stock in the last year is $252.0833.

VEEV has been the topic of a number of recent research reports. Evercore reissued an “outperform” rating and issued a $185.00 target price on shares of Veeva Systems in a report on Thursday, June 4th. TD Cowen restated a “buy” rating on shares of Veeva Systems in a research note on Thursday, June 4th. Wall Street Zen lowered shares of Veeva Systems from a “buy” rating to a “hold” rating in a research report on Monday, August 3rd. BTIG Research reiterated a “buy” rating and issued a $340.00 price objective on shares of Veeva Systems in a research note on Thursday, June 4th. Finally, Oppenheimer raised their price objective on shares of Veeva Systems from $225.00 to $300.00 and gave the stock an “outperform” rating in a report on Monday.

Veeva Systems Trading Down 2.2%

Shares of VEEV opened at $238.40 on Tuesday. The firm has a market cap of $38.73 billion, a PE ratio of 42.50, a P/E/G ratio of 1.05 and a beta of 0.92. The firm has a fifty day simple moving average of $191.38 and a two-hundred day simple moving average of $180.68. Veeva Systems has a 1-year low of $148.05 and a 1-year high of $310.50.

Veeva Systems (NYSE:VEEVG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, June 3rd. The technology company reported $2.24 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$2.14 by $0.10. The firm had revenue of $882.95 million for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$857.73 million. Veeva Systems had a return on equity of 13.72% and a net margin of 28.37%.The company’s revenue was up 16.3%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the prior year, the firm earned $1.97 EPS. Veeva Systems has set its FY 2027 guidance at 9.050-9.050 EPS and its Q2 2027 guidance at 2.210-2.220 EPS. As a group, research analysts forecast that Veeva Systems will post 6.65 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Insider Activity

In other news, insider Thomas D. Schwenger sold 36,000 shares of the business’s stock in a transaction on Thursday, August 13th. The shares were sold at an average price of $250.23, for a total transaction of $9,008,280.00. Following the completion of the sale, the insider owned 19,449 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$4,866,723.27. The trade was a 64.92% decrease in their position. The sale was disclosed in a legal filing with the SEC, which is available at this link. The transaction was executed under a pre-arranged Rule 10b5-1 trading plan. 10.60% of the stock is currently owned by insiders.

About Veeva Systems

Veeva Systems (NYSE: VEEV) is a cloud software company that develops industry-specific applications and data solutions for the global life sciences sector. Founded in 2007 and headquartered in Pleasanton, California, Veeva focuses on helping pharmaceutical, biotechnology, medical device and consumer health companies manage regulated content, clinical and regulatory processes, quality systems, and commercial operations in a compliant, cloud-native environment. The company completed its initial public offering in 2013 and has since expanded its product suite and international footprint.

Veeva’s product portfolio centers on its Vault platform and related application suites, which provide content and data management, clinical trial and regulatory workflows, quality management, and structured commercial capabilities such as customer relationship management and promotional content management.
